O. Dahari is a scholar working on Astronomy and Astrophysics, Instrumentation and Statistical and Nonlinear Physics. According to data from OpenAlex, O. Dahari has authored 10 papers receiving a total of 478 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Astronomy and Astrophysics, 7 papers in Instrumentation and 3 papers in Statistical and Nonlinear Physics. Recurrent topics in O. Dahari’s work include Astronomy and Astrophysical Research (7 papers), Stellar, planetary, and galactic studies (4 papers) and Scientific Research and Discoveries (3 papers). O. Dahari is often cited by papers focused on Astronomy and Astrophysical Research (7 papers), Stellar, planetary, and galactic studies (4 papers) and Scientific Research and Discoveries (3 papers). O. Dahari collaborates with scholars based in United States, Israel and Canada. O. Dahari's co-authors include M. M. De Robertis, Donald E. Osterbrock, George H. Jacoby, Holland Ford, Robin Ciardullo, P. C. Crane, R. W. Goodrich and Jan Ekberg and has published in prestigious journals such as The Astrophysical Journal, The Astrophysical Journal Supplement Series and The Astronomical Journal.
